Parracombe Prize

Deadline date - 31st January 2023

1st November 2022 12:01am to 31st January 2023 11:59pm, Parracombe Community Trust

An annual international competition for short stories written in English. The top 35 stories will be published in our anthology. Running from 2020, the maximum length of story corresponds with the year (so for 2023 it will be 2023 words). There is no minimum length, but flash fiction might do better when entered in designated flash fiction competitions.

Entry costs of £5 per story are kept to a minimum to enable authors of modest means to participate. The stories are judged by a community of up ten judges and every story will be read by at least five of them.

This competition is run by the not-for-profit Parracombe Community Trust.
